Output 64a8073355d9c4d47a28760fc8f69b6eabfa7c5ad9e2cd9866d55d3003312108:2

value
851117
script pubkey
OP_0 OP_PUSHBYTES_20 8046ed47509e093590878c6b81c6706da0887a43
address
bc1qsprw636sncyntyy8334cr3nsdksgs7jrs3l8dm
transaction
64a8073355d9c4d47a28760fc8f69b6eabfa7c5ad9e2cd9866d55d3003312108
confirmations
53244
spent
true